In addition, the Student Services Department maintains a list of students by zip code to aid in carpooling efforts. Many students prefer to carpool because they:
- Don't have their own transportation
- Want to save money on gas
- Precautionary - their car may not be reliable for daily commuting
Each year an increasing number of students find that they are no longer covered by their parents' insurance or that higher co-pays and deductibles leave them with much greater out-of-pocket expenses for health care than in the past. To assist students in finding affordable insurance, the MTC offers an Insurance Policy through the Chesapeake Life Insurance Company, administered through First Risk Advisors, Inc.
Group-level dental benefits are available to our students through Dominion Dental Services' eDental program.
We recognize students may face a wide range of life challenges. Therefore, the MTC maintains a contractual relationship with WellSpan Health Services to provide enrolled students with free confidential counseling and support.
Many students who attend MTC need to find affordable child care during school and work times. Our Student Services Department offers assistance to students in helping them locate child care.
Part-time work can help you meet your financial obligations and provide you with valuable work experiences. Our Student Services stay in contact with local companies to keep a current listing of open positions. Some companies offer tuition assistance to part-time employees!
Also, part-time work may be available at the Motorcycle Technology Center or YTI Career Institute through the Federal Work-Study Program. Your Financial Planner can supply details on the program.
